Output cd30a614155f5cf076b8251f27e2b94b4ca9e9fcd118d4ebe43466e16ef49690:32

value
35383975
script pubkey
OP_0 OP_PUSHBYTES_20 8d4e576171d4f1d579f908457e337e9516163f62
address
bc1q3489wct36nca270eppzhuvm7j5tpv0mz0gqeg3
transaction
cd30a614155f5cf076b8251f27e2b94b4ca9e9fcd118d4ebe43466e16ef49690